Description

In this talk I will summarize recent advances in the description of symmetry-breaking defects in quantum gravity theories. These are important to ensure that there are no global symmetries in the UV. In particular, I will analyze global symmetries that originate from topological features of the theory at low-energy and can be associated to deformation classes described by bordism groups. I will then use this approach to analyze well-known models such as maximal supergravity theories.
